    Abstract: A system for purifying impurity-infused water includes a CO2 input tubular, a CO2 output tubular, a CO2 hydrate-former vessel configured to form CO2 hydrates using the CO2 from the CO2 input tubular and the impurity-infused water. The system also includes a CO2 hydrate-dissociator vessel configured receive CO2 hydrates from the CO2 hydrate-former vessel and to dissociate the CO2 hydrates into purified water and dissociated CO2 by heating the CO2 hydrates. The system further includes a CO2 compressor configured to receive the dissociated CO2 from the CO2 hydrate-dissociator vessel, compress the dissociated CO2, and discharge compressed CO2 into the CO2 output tubular. The CO2 hydrate-former vessel includes an impurity solution output for discharging an impurity solution having impurities removed from the impurity-infused water by the formation of the CO2 hydrates. The CO2 hydrate-dissociator vessel includes a heating device configured to heat the CO2 hydrates to dissociate them.

    Abstract: The disclosure concerns an abrasive gas turbine blade tip cap preform for bonding to a blade tip to form an abrasive blade tip cap, the abrasive gas turbine blade tip cap preform being formed of a bonding layer and an abrasive layer, the bonding layer being a metallic layer comprising powder size particles of a nickel braze alloy and a nickel base superalloy, and the abrasive layer being a ceramic layer in a metal matrix comprising powder size particles of cubic boron nitride (cBN) and aluminum oxide (Al2O3) in a metal matrix of same composition of the bonding layer. The disclosure also concerns a method of manufacturing an abrasive gas turbine blade tip cap preform and a method of bonding the abrasive gas turbine blade tip cap preform to a blade tip to form an abrasive blade tip cap.

    Abstract: A valve comprising a body having a cylindrical sliding seat and an opening for the passage of air; a plunger sliding axially inside the aforementioned seat, for regulating the aforementioned air supply opening; and an electromagnet, the core of which presents a rod fitting through an axial hole on the plunger. According to the present invention, the plunger is connected elastically to the rod by means of two springs, each designed to exert elastic force on the plunger in the opposite direction to that of the other spring; regulating means being provided for enabling predetermined preloading of both springs.
